Hundreds of youths join AJSU Party in Hazaribag

Jharkhand, Dec 14 (UNI) AJSU Party chief and former Deputy Chief Minister Sudesh Mahto on Sunday said that policies driven by short-term electoral gains were hindering Jharkhand's long-term progress.
Addressing a party induction programme at Hazaribag Town Hall, he stressed the need for a clear vision and long-term roadmap for the state.
Hundreds of youths joined the AJSU Party under the leadership of Shashibhushan Kesari at the event. Leaders including Mandu MLA Nirmal Mahato, former MLA Dr. Lambodar Mahato, chief spokesperson Dr. Devsharan Bhagat, central vice-president Praveen Prabhakar and general secretary Sanjay Mehta also addressed the gathering.
